ASCOR (ascorbic acid injection) for intravenous use is a colorless to pale yellow, preservative-free, hypertonic, sterile, non-pyrogenic solution of ascorbic acid. ASCOR must be diluted with an appropriate infusion solution (e.g., 5% Dextrose Injection, USP, Sterile Water for Injection, USP) [see Dosage and Administration (2.1) ] . The chemical name of Ascorbic Acid is L -ascorbic acid. The molecular formula is C 6 H 8 O 6 . It has the following structural formula: Each ASCOR, 50 mL, Pharmacy Bulk Package vial contains 25,000 mg ascorbic acid, equivalent to 28,125 mg sodium ascorbate. Each mL of ASCOR contains 500 mg of ascorbic acid (equivalent to 562.5 mg of sodium ascorbate which amounts to 65 mg sodium/mL of ASCOR), 130 mg of Sodium bicarbonate, and 0.25mg of edetate disodium. Sodium hydroxide is added for pH adjustment (pH range 5.6-6.6). It contains no bacteriostatic or antimicrobial agent. formula

INDICATIONS AND USAGE Supplementation of the diet with ten essential vitamins. Supplementation of the diet with fluoride for caries prophylaxis. Multivitamin with 1 mg Fluoride Chewable Tablets provide fluoride in tablet form for children 6-16 years of age in areas where the water fluoride level is less than 0.3 ppm. Multivitamin with 0.5 mg Fluoride Chewable Tablets provide fluoride in tablet form for children 4-6 years of age where the water fluoride level is less than 0.3 ppm, and for children 6 years of age and above where the drinking water contains 0.3 through 0.6 ppm of fluoride. Multivitamin with 0.25 mg Fluoride Chewable Tablets provide fluoride in tablet form for children 4-6 years of age where the drinking water contains 0.3 through 0.6 ppm of fluoride. Multivitamin with Fluoride Chewable Tablets supply significant amounts of Vitamins A, C, D, E, thiamin, riboflavin, niacin, vitamin B6, vitamin B12, and folate to supplement the diet, and to help assure that nutritional deficiencies of these vitamins will not develop. Thus, in a single easy-to-use preparation, children obtain ten essential vitamins and the important mineral, fluoride. The American Academy of Pediatrics recommends that children up to age 16, in areas where drinking water contains less than optimal levels of fluoride, receive daily fluoride supplementation. Children using Multivitamin with Fluoride Chewable Tablets regularly should receive semiannual dental examinations. The regular brushing of teeth and attention to good oral hygiene practices are also essential.

Tube description A moisturizing sun lotion for the face and body with a high sun protection factor. Caution: Apply sunscreen liberally before sun exposure. Applying an insufficient amount of sunscreen will reduce the level of sun protection (i.e. the SPF) indicated. Avoid intensive midday sun. Reapply frequently in order to maintain protection, especially after perspiring, swimming or drying off with a towel. Shield babies and toddlers from direct UV radiation, dress them in protective clothing and use a sunscreen with a minimum SPF of 25. Do not over expose yourself to the sun, even if you are using a sunscreen.
